How much do assortment planner j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for assortment planner in Ohio is $70,423.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$48,500.00 and $93,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assortment planner do?

An Assortment Planner is responsible for analyzing sales data, market trends, and inventory levels to create optimal product assortments for retail stores or e-commerce platforms. They collaborate with merchandising, buying, and planning teams to ensure the right mix of products is available to meet customer demand while maximizing profitability. Their role involves forecasting, financial planning, and inventory management to balance stock levels and minimize risk. Effective assortment planning helps retailers drive sales, reduce markdowns, and improve overall business performance.

What does a typical workday look like for an assortment planner?

A typical workday for an Assortment Planner involves analyzing sales data, monitoring inventory levels, and collaborating closely with buyers, category managers, and supply chain teams to ensure the right product mix in stores or online channels. You may also spend time reviewing market trends, forecasting seasonal demand, and adjusting assortments to optimize sales and minimize excess inventory. Frequent meetings and strategy sessions with merchandising and planning teams are common, along with regular communication with vendors. Most roles are office-based, though some companies offer hybrid or remote options. The pace can be fast, especially during planning cycles, but the variety of tasks makes the role both dynamic and rewarding.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assortment planner?

To thrive as an Assortment Planner,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a background in merchandising, retail management, or a similar field. Familiarity with planning software such as SAP, Oracle Retail, or JDA, and proficiency in Excel are commonly required, with some employers valuing APICS certification. Effective communication, collaboration, and problem-solving abilities help Assortment Planners work well with cross-functional teams and manage vendor relationships. Mastering these skills ensures accurate inventory decisions and product mixes, driving sales and optimizing stock for business success.

As an Associate Merchandise Planner, you play a key role in shaping how product performs across the business. You'll turn data into insights that influence real decisions, helping ensure the right product is in the right place at the right time. Working closely with Merchandising and cross-functional partners, you'll contribute to strategies that balance opportunity and risk while driving results across key items.
What You'll Be Doing
Planning & Strategy
• Build and manage weekly sales, markdown, and receipt plans for key items using both historical data and emerging trends
• Translate item strategies into actionable financial plans using Enterprise Planning tools and performance metrics
• Partner with cross-functional teams to establish pre-season financial targets aligned with the merchant vision
Performance Analysis & Insights
• Analyze in-season performance and identify opportunities to maximize sales, optimize in-stock levels, and mitigate risk
• Deliver bottoms-up reporting and ad hoc analyses to recap item-level performance
• Use hindsight and in-season insights to inform future assortment strategies
Business Influence & Decision Support
• Develop clear, solution-oriented recommendations that drive business outcomes
• Influence Merchandise Planners by sharing data-driven insights to optimize forecasts
• Bring a thoughtful point of view grounded in analysis to support decision-making
• Proactively recommend next steps to enable timely, informed actions
Collaboration & Communication
• Partner with Store Planning and Allocation teams to align inventory plans with store targets
• Participate in cross-functional business meetings to ensure alignment with merchandise strategies
• Facilitate monthly key item review meetings, sharing insights on performance, risks, and opportunities
• Communicate financial concepts clearly and effectively across a variety of audiences
What You'll Need
Experience
• Minimum of 3 years experience in Planning, Allocation, Buying, financial analysis, or a combination of planning and merchant experience
Education
• BA or BS in Business, Finance, or related field
Skills
• Strong financial and analytical skills, including data retrieval, organization, and presentation
• Ability to prioritize effectively and adapt to changing demands, with strong time management skills
• Clear written and verbal communication skills, particularly when communicating financial concepts
• Proficiency in Excel, MicroStrategy, and Enterprise Planning tools
• Ability to form a point of view, influence others with data, and recommend strategic actions
